Michael Francis "Mick" Foley, Sr. (born June 7, 1965) is an American retired professional wrestler, author, comedian, actor, voice actor and former color commentator. He has worked for many wrestling promotions, including WWE, World Championship Wrestling (WCW), Extreme Championship Wrestling (ECW), Total Nonstop Action Wrestling (TNA), National Wrestling Alliance (NWA) as well as numerous promotions in Japan. He is often referred to as "The Hardcore Legend", a nickname he shares with Terry Funk.Foley has wrestled both under his real name and various personas, including Dude Love, Cactus Jack, and Mankind, also known as the Three Faces of Foley. Foley is a four-time world champion (three WWF Championships, and one TNA World Heavyweight Championship), an 11-time tag team champion (eight WWF Tag Team Titles, two ECW World Tag Team Titles, and one WCW World Tag Team Championship), the first WWF Hardcore Champion, and a one-time TNA Legends Champion. Foley headlined many pay-per-views for WWE from the mid-1990s to the mid 2000s; he participated in the closing matches of WrestleMania XV and WrestleMania 2000 – as a special guest referee in the former.

1In his first autobiography, "Have A Nice Day: A Tale of Blood and Sweatsocks," he mentioned that he had been reading about various psychological conditions while thinking up ideas for his Mankind character. One of Mankind's unusual habits was pulling out his hair at random intervals. While not acknowledged in Mick's book or by WWE, this is a legitimate psychological condition, known as Trichotillomania.

9For many years, he claimed his missing front teeth were kicked out by Sting during a match. In his book "Have a Nice Day!", he reveals they were actually knocked out when Foley was involved in a car accident in the late 1980s.
10Parents were Jack and Beverly Foley. His mother was a former government worker. His dad served as the athletic director at Ward Melville High School for many years and was the inspiration for the Cactus Jack character. He died on September 14, 2009 at the age of 76.

31Contrary to popular belief, never actually "won" the WWF Hardcore Championship. It was given to him as a gift by Vince McMahon.
32Took his trademark catchphrase "Bang, Bang!" from the B-52's song "Love Shack." For some mysterious reason, the song had been running through his head, and he held his fingers up like pistols, and recited the "bang bang banging on the door..." verse.
33The episode of WWE Raw (1993) on which he won his first WWF Championship was taped 6 days before it aired. Foley did not tell his 2 kids that he had won, so he could watch it with them on TV and see their surprise.
34On an episode of rival program WCW Monday Nitro (1995), WCW commentator Tony Schiavone sarcastically remarked on Foley's WWE Title win, "That'll put asses in the seats." Thousands of Foley fans replied by carrying signs to WWF events reading, "Mick Foley put my ass in this seat" for the year to follow.

49March 16, 1994: Foley lost 2/3 of his right ear in a match against Vader (Leon White) in Munich, Germany.
50Some of his other injuries include: A broken jaw, fractured left shoulder, broken right wrist, a broken toe, two broken noses, second degree burns and a total of over 300 stitches all over his body. 1998: In an intensely brutal Hell in a Cell match vs The Undertaker, Foley had, his shoulder and jaw dislocated and a tooth knocked into his nose.
51Retired from pro wrestling on February 27, 2000, after losing to "Hunter Hearst Helmsley" in a Hell in a Cell cage match, but returned for one night only two months later to participate in the main event of WrestleMania 2000.
